An atmospheric photograph at Exeter Central station depicts a two-carClass 118 DMU leaving with the 17.46 Exmouth to Exeter St. David's service. The DMU was a long-term West Country resident, built by the Birmingham RC&W set P481 composed of W51327 and W51312. In the background, Exeter Central signal box is seen along with some of its associated semaphores. Notice the two BR staff chatting on the platform end rather than eagerly observing (obsessively even?) a departing train as a 'dispatcher' does today. |
